Accession register · barcode desk · OPAC on the portals
Titles carry the bibliographic detail that matters and no more. Each physical copy has its own accession number, location and status, which is what makes stock verification and loss tracking possible.
Circulation is built around a barcode scanner and a keyboard. Policies for how many items and how many days apply by member type, so the librarian is not deciding case by case.
Due-soon and overdue notices reach students and guardians on the channels the school already uses, which recovers far more books than a fine ever does.
The catalogue appears on the student and parent portals, so a child can check whether a book is in before walking to the library, and renew without queuing at the desk.
Circulation rules are what stop a library quietly losing a quarter of its stock.
A physical copy can only be on loan to one member at a time — which is why copies are tracked, not just titles.
Issuing beyond a member type’s item or renewal limit is blocked rather than discouraged.
A withdrawn copy keeps its accession number with a withdrawn status, so the register stays continuous.
Fines are calculated by a daily job, so two members with the same overdue are treated identically.
A freed copy goes to the next member in the queue, with a notification and a hold period.
A verification run records what was scanned and what was missing, as a dated report.
